Output ab777528a48f86901eb54f7aa92e2417e340abbdd38d1b0146c658be74b9dfc9:3

value
9926836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 753e58570ff62015f25117c1fe3e62a95199c7e3 OP_EQUAL
address
MJb5ygm6xpofgUThjZPfthaiytovMUiA2W
transaction
ab777528a48f86901eb54f7aa92e2417e340abbdd38d1b0146c658be74b9dfc9
spent
true